3 Wheel

A 3-wheel scooter features two wheels at the back and one wheel in front to steer. This kind of mobility scooters are generally lighter and more maneuverable than the 4-wheel scooter, making it easier to get around in tight spaces. However, it is not as sturdy and may be difficult to drive on rough terrain, such as gravel, sand, or gravel.

If you're unsure whether a three- or four-wheel mobility scooter is best for you, it's an excellent idea to talk to the sales staff at your local scooter shop. They can help you determine the most appropriate option depending on your requirements and budget. They can also provide information on financing, payment plans, or the possibility of insurance covering the cost of a scooter.

4 Wheel

Four-wheeled mobility scooters are more stable and have a wider base than three-wheel or two-wheel models. However, they're not as compact or lightweight and could require a bigger storage space in your home. Four-wheeled vehicles are generally heavier and have a captain's chair that is well cushioned to ensure comfort on long journeys. Some Medicare and private insurance policies cover the cost of these scooters if a doctor certifies that they are medically required.

It is best to purchase the scooter with four wheels from a local shop, where you can experience different models and talk to an expert. A lot of stores have showrooms that let you test several models with different seats and features prior to making a purchase. Some even offer financing, so that you can pay for your scooter over time, rather than in one lump sum.

folding mobility scooter for sale near me/Travel

The best mobility scooters for traveling with are those that can be folded into a compact, easy-to-carry form. They are also extremely light in weight so that they can be easily transported on cars, trains and planes. There are manual scooters that you have to fold manually, as well as automated ones that fold automatically.

Golden Technologies' Buzzaround LT is a great option for those who are looking for a light and small-sized scooter. It can be disassembled into a number of smaller pieces, and its heaviest piece weighs less than 40 lbs. It is among the cheapest and most popular mobility scooters that travel on the market.

The LiteRider HD5 by Pride Mobility is another good option. The compact scooter features an extremely powerful battery that can allow it to travel as far as 9 miles on a single charge, and its heaviest piece only weighs 44 lbs. Heavy Duty

Mobility scooters can prove to be lifesaver for those who are heavier or have disabilities that make walking difficult. Heavy duty scooters are made to accommodate a higher capacity of weight, and often come with bigger wheels, higher ground clearance and a suspension that provides a more comfortable ride. They can also be driven at higher speeds, allowing users to cover more distance in a single charge without having to recharge.

When selecting a durable mobility scooter, it is important to take into consideration the weight capacity, the frame size and shape, as well as its weight. To achieve this, look for a model with a wide stable base and a swivel or reclining seat. Some models have additional stability features such as small wheels on the back of the frame that help keep the chair from falling over when descending or climbing downward hills.

A mobility scooter with a wide turning radius is a crucial feature. This will make it easier for you to maneuver the chair around tight spaces and avoid any obstacles. Certain models come with a lockable basket that could be used to store groceries or other things.

Some heavy-duty scooters can be able to handle various terrains, such as gravel and grass. This can be particularly beneficial for those who reside in rural areas or who prefer to take a trip outdoors instead of sticking to the safety of paved sidewalks. These models may have a 5.5" ground clearance, and have 14" front and 16" rear flat-free suspension tires.
